Concrete is porous by nature. Without proper sealing, moisture can seep in, causing cracks, spalling, and mold growth. A quality non-leaching sealer blocks these threats while letting vapor escape—a balance crucial for longevity.
Properly applied, these sealers:
- Resist water penetration and freeze-thaw cycles
- Repel oil, grease, and chemical spills
- Enhance visual appeal with consistent finishes
- Reduce long-term maintenance costs

Penetrating Sealers
Penetrate deep into pores, providing internal protection. Best for porous surfaces needing long-lasting defense without altering appearance.
Acrylic Sealers
Form a thin, breathable film on the surface. Good for decorative finishes but less durable under heavy traffic compared to penetrating types.
Epoxy and Polyurethane Coatings
Create a thick, protective layer. Ideal for high-wear areas like garages and industrial floors, but require meticulous prep and ventilation.
Key Differences, Pros, and Best Use Cases
- Penetrating: Low maintenance, transparent.
- Acrylic: Quick-dry, aesthetic-friendly.
- Epoxy/Polyurethane: Extremely tough, but more complex application.
Choosing the right type depends on your surface, climate, and intended use.

Surface Preparation
- Clean thoroughly to remove dirt, oil, and old sealers.
- Repair cracks and allow full drying.
- Use a pressure washer if necessary, but avoid excess moisture.
Tools Needed
- Clean, lint-free rags or rollers
- Applicator sprayer or brush
- Protective gloves and eyewear
Application Process
1. Test on a small area first.
2. Apply evenly in thin coats.
3. Allow proper drying between layers.
4. Avoid application in extreme heat or rain.
Drying and Curing
Follow manufacturer guidelines—typically 24 hours before traffic. Full cure may take up to 72 hours.
Safety Tips
Ventilate the area, wear protective gear, and keep pets and children away during curing.
Common Mistakes to Avoid
- Skipping Surface Prep: Dirt and moisture trap contaminants, reducing adhesion.
- Applying Too Thick/Thin: Over-application wastes product and can cause bubbling; too thin offers insufficient coverage.
- Wrong Product Selection: Using a surface-specific sealer on the wrong substrate leads to failure.
- Poor Weather Timing: Humidity or rain can compromise curing.
- Over-Application: Excess material can create sticky residues and uneven texture.
Maintenance and Reapplication
Most high-quality non-leaching sealers last 3–5 years depending on conditions. Signs you need reapplication include water no longer beads up, increased staining, or visible wear. Regular cleaning with pH-neutral products preserves seal integrity. Always follow manufacturer recommendations for reapplication intervals.

Q: Can I apply sealer over existing sealers?
A: Only if the previous layer is fully cured and compatible. Otherwise, removal and prep are recommended.
Q: Will these sealers change the color of my concrete?
A: Most maintain natural tones. Some darken slightly; test first.
Q: Are FDA-grade sealers safe for driveways used by kids or pets?
A: Yes, when properly cured and applied according to instructions.
Q: How do I know if my sealer is working?
A: Check for beading of water after application. If not, reapply or assess surface condition.
Q: Can I apply sealer in winter?
A: Not recommended. Cold temperatures slow curing and reduce effectiveness.
